Onsite backup vs offsite backup

Onsite backup and offsite backup are two types of backup methods used for data protection on server operating systems, providing users with a reliable way to safeguard their data.

Onsite backup refers to storing data on a local device, such as hard drives or USB drives, while offsite backup involves storing data remotely, either via the internet or in another physical location, like a cloud drive or network share.

Both onsite and remote backups have their own advantages and disadvantages, and they can complement each other. Onsite backups are easier to set up and provide quick access, but can be easily lost. Remote backups are more complex, but offer extra protection for important data.

In need of Windows Server offsite backup

Onsite backups are stored near the source and can be vulnerable to computer viruses, system failures, and physical disasters, making them unreliable.

Windows Server OffSite Backup

From another perspective Offsite backup provides stronger security for servers by storing crucial business data and customer information remotely, minimizing downtime and economic losses in case of server failure.

Reliable tool for Windows Server remote backup

To create a remote backup, you can use the Windows Server Backup utility, which involves creating a VHD or VHDX file using Disk Management. For a detailed guide, you can visit the Windows Server backup incremental to network share page, but note that this method can only keep one backup copy on the network drive.
